Subject[ 030/218] bnx2x: fix 57840_MF pci id

From: Yuval Mintz <yuvalmin@broadcom.com>

[ Upstream commit 5c879d2094946081af934739850c7260e8b25d3c ]

Commit c3def943c7117d42caaed3478731ea7c3c87190e have added support for
new pci ids of the 57840 board, while failing to change the obsolete value
in 'pci_ids.h'.
This patch does so, allowing the probe of such devices.

include/linux/pci_ids.h |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

--- a/include/linux/pci_ids.h
+++ b/include/linux/pci_ids.h
@@ -2148,7 +2148,7 @@
#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_TIGON3_5704S 0x16a8
#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_NX2_57800_VF 0x16a9
#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_NX2_5706S 0x16aa
-#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_NX2_57840_MF 0x16ab
+#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_NX2_57840_MF 0x16a4
#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_NX2_5708S 0x16ac
#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_NX2_57840_VF 0x16ad
#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_NX2_57810_MF 0x16ae
